Playing as Germany, I annexed the Dutch East Indies in 1937 and set them up as a puppet. In 1941, while reviewing my armies, I noticed the Dutch East Indies puppet defense army was missing. Upon investigation, I discovered that the puppet had freed itself without any notification or popup. They are now an independent country with no faction affiliation, even though I have a negative autonomy "master" tick, which should ensure integration, not liberation. Additionally:They were not participating in my ongoing war.
Despite being independent, I still receive all their resources for free through trade, which seems inconsistent with mechanics.
Steps to Reproduce
Play as Germany in 1936.Annex the Dutch East Indies and set them as a puppet in 1937.
Continue gameplay until 1941, monitoring puppet status and autonomy progress.
Check puppet autonomy and status – observe if they free themselves contrary to mechanics.
